Abstract

The invention provides a device having first and second balloons. Each of the first and second balloons communicates with an inflation lumen. A differential pressure gauge communicates with both inflation lumens. Each of the inflation lumens also communicates independently with a pump for inflating the balloon. The pressure gauge may include a shut-off valve for terminating inflation in the second balloon when the pressure within the first balloon exceeds the pressure in the second balloon. The pressure gauge may also include a pressure limiter. Methods of using the devices for measuring diameter and pressure of a balloon occluder deployed in a vessel or body cavity are disclosed.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
         1 . A balloon occlusion inflation apparatus, comprising: 
 a first balloon which communicates with a first inflation lumen;    a second balloon which communicates with a second inflation lumen; and    a pressure gauge communicating with the first inflation lumen and independently and simultaneously communicating with the second inflation lumen to permit a comparison of a detected pressure of the first balloon with a detected pressure of the second balloon.    
     
     
         2 . The apparatus of  claim 1 , wherein the first and second balloons are elastomeric.  
     
     
         3 . The apparatus of  claim 1 , wherein the first and second balloons are non-elastomeric.  
     
     
         4 . The apparatus of  claim 1 , further comprising a first pump that communicates with the first inflation lumen and a second pump that communicates with the second inflation lumen, wherein the first and second pumps are syringes.  
     
     
         5 . The apparatus of  claim 4 , wherein the syringes are tandem acting syringes.  
     
     
         6 . The apparatus of  claim 1 , wherein the pressure gauge includes a shut-off valve, operably associated with the second inflation lumen.  
     
     
         7 . The apparatus of  claim 1 , wherein the pressure gauge includes a pressure limiter.  
     
     
         8 . The apparatus of  claim 1 , wherein the pressure gauge is a differential pressure gauge.  
     
     
         9 . The apparatus of  claim 1 , further comprising a first pump communicating with the first inflation lumen and a second pump communicating with the second inflation lumen.
